Top Valliammai Institute Of Hotel Management | Reviews & Ratings | comparemela.com
Valliammai institute of hotel management in India - 604002/ near tindivanam
Valliammai institute of hotel management in India - 744104/ near villupuram
Valliammai institute of hotel management in India - 604002/ near tindivanam